“On Easter Saturday April 7th Sywell Aviation Museum opens its doors for the 2007 season, thereafter is open from 10.30 to 16.30hrs every weekend and bank holiday until the end of September. Group visits are available outside those times – so if you belong to a group who would like a tour please contact us!

The Museum is located adjacent to the aircraft viewing area, next to The Aviator Hotel, bar and restaurant and is a perfect afternoon out – especially for children.

All displays have been completely overhauled and refreshed for 2007 and include a brand new wartime kitchen, aircraft ordnance display – including Sidewinder air to air missile! Visitors can see displayed (for the first time in 90 years!) a Zeppelin bomb dropped on Northampton in 1917, as featured in TV’s Look East late last year.

Our brand new display for 2007 is of Wartime and Aviation toys including tinplate, clockwork trains and novelties many made by Mettoy and Bassett-Lowke of Northampton

For the grand opening on April 7th our friends from the Troops Trucks & Stores Military Vehicle Group will be bringing their collection of wartime military vehicles including jeeps, lorries and an armoured American M3 Halftrack!
